1. H-1B Visa for Skilled Workers

Why the H-1B Visa?

  • For Highly Skilled Professionals: The H-1B visa is one of the most popular U.S. work visas for professionals in IT, engineering, healthcare, and more.
  • Employer-Sponsored Visa: You must have a job offer from a U.S. employer who is willing to sponsor your visa.
  • Pathway to Green Card: After working on an H-1B visa, many professionals apply for permanent residency through employer sponsorship.

2. L-1 Visa for Intra-Company Transfers

Why the L-1 Visa?

  • For Global Companies: The L-1 visa allows multinational companies to transfer executives, managers, or employees with specialized knowledge to their U.S. offices.
  • Fast Processing: The L-1 visa often has faster processing times compared to other work visas.
  • Pathway to Green Card: L-1 visa holders can eventually apply for a Green Card through employment-based residency categories.

3. O-1 Visa for Individuals with Extraordinary Ability

Why the O-1 Visa?

  • For Exceptional Talent: The O-1 visa is designed for individuals with extraordinary abilities in fields like science, education, business, arts, or athletics.
  • No Cap or Lottery: Unlike the H-1B, the O-1 visa does not have an annual cap or lottery, providing more flexibility for applicants.
  • Path to Green Card: Many O-1 visa holders can transition to permanent residency through the EB-1 category for extraordinary ability.

4. Employment-Based Green Cards (EB Visas)

Why EB Visas?

  • Permanent Residency: Employment-based Green Cards allow professionals to live and work permanently in the U.S.
  • Wide Range of Categories: From EB-1 for extraordinary ability professionals to EB-3 for skilled and unskilled workers, there are various categories depending on your qualifications.
  • Family Benefits: Once you secure a Green Card, your immediate family members can also live and work in the U.S.
